ETA: You can also use a set created for another maker, if that other maker is ok with it (I'll allow anyone to use mine), with one modification. The prompt "random remake" is maker-specific, so you need to re-randomize that one instead of using the other maker's icon. Here's a simple method to do that:
1. Choose how many icon posts you're willing to go back to (min 10). This number is N.
2. Use a random number generator (this one for example) to randomize between 1-N.
3. Count N sets back from the latest icon post in your icon community. This is the post from which a random remake icon is selected.
4. Use a random number generator to pick an icon from the post.
I used a much more complex method that considered every single post in the community, but that's too much effort and counting so you can use this simplified version.

Are the icon limits still 5-20? I've seen some makers enter more icons into a round, is that allowed now?
As it stands, the limit is 5-20 per set. You can still make more than one separate set for a challenge. The reason there is any upper limit is just to avoid low effort spam iconing, nobody wants to look at a giant set of 100+ icons in a single poll. If the maker at least has to think about how to arrange those icons into different sets, and preferably also create separate entries into this comm for each one, that should avoid this problem, and even if not, at least voting in 5 20-icon sets is much easier than in a single 100-icon set. I realize this is splitting hairs and we might need to revisit this rule in the future if something like this starts happening a lot, but for the moment I think allowing more than one separate set for a challenge has been a positive thing.
TL;DR - Yes, the rule is to make 5-20 icons per set (except for round 9 which you can still enter 4-21 icons per set), but you can make as many sets as you want for a round, including this extra round.
